I am currently switching from a woo multivendor store to cs cart. I see vendor plans ect, have read the documentation but don't feel i clearly get it. I simply want to have a 7% commission straight across the board for all vendors. With the ability to set individual vendors commissions myself as the store owner as i offer military discounts of only 3.5% and don't charge non profits a commission at all, they all sell for free is this possible without vendor plans?

I just want it a simple sign up everyone who signs up doesn't have to chose a plan or anything like that. As simple as possible. Not to mention everyone would go for the free and half price plan. I don't charge listing fees or monthly fees just a commission is all, and i don't feel like sifting through vendor plans and finding out for myself who is and who isn't what they say they are.

The vendor plans are pretty easy. You could setup three plans in about 5 minutes. One general plan no fee and 7% commission, one military plan no fee and 3.5% commission and the third plan = non-profits no fee and 0% commission.

I see how i can do that but how does that stop joe blow and everyone else from just choosing the free one when they dont qualify?

I see how i can do that but how does that stop joe blow and everyone else from just choosing the free one when they dont qualify?


What if you made those plans hidden, leaving only the 7%-commission plan active? That way applying vendors will only be able to select the 7% plan, and you'll be able to assign other plans yourself as you see fit.

You can also create a menu item that leads applying vendors straight to the application form, skipping the plan selection page. This article describes the process in more detail. Here's the example of the URL that leads straight to the application form:

http://example.com/index.php?dispatch=companies.apply_for_vendor

There is also a way to prevent vendors from switching to other plans themselves.

Awesome Thank you for that! I assume the vendor plans is the only way to go and that there isn't a way to just do a straight commission? Again thanks for the documentation.

You're welcome, Adam. Yes, ever since version 4.4.1 the vendor plans are the only way to go.
By the way, you might also find it convenient to assign plans to multiple vendors at once by importing a CSV file.

When I am on a vendors account even though i have two of the three vendor plans hidden it still shows that they can change it to the others?


Yes, the Plan tab still appears even if you forbid vendors from switching to other plans. That way vendors can quickly review the conditions they're selling on.


Is there a documentation on setting up multivendor real time shipping and paypal adaptive payments? I see the documents for normal cs cart i just wasn't sure if it was the same as multi vendor?


The documentation covers both CS-Cart and Multi-Vendor. When the behaviour is different in CS-Cart or Multi-Vendor, the articles usually mention it. Here are the articles about PayPal Adaptive Payments and about real time shipping methods.
